Draft Grade — Jaguars
Overall B-
ValueC+ NeedB+ TradesB- FutureB-
A solid, sensible weekend for the Jaguars: B-.

Somewhere a scout is still blinking. The Jaguars spent No. 124 on Red Murdock, a name the board had a full 64 spots lower.

On value alone, Lew makes the weekend a net positive. For all the activity, interior defensive lineman went untouched, which is hard to explain. They went 6 of 9 on their needs, which is most of what a draft is for.

In short, they left a little better than they arrived, which is the whole idea.
